Fresh sweet figs with soft goat cheese over baby arugula topped with a balsamic glaze. A beautiful salad without the fuss, using only 5 ingredients; this salad will make you look like a rock star in the kitchen!

Once revered as a symbol of peace and prosperity, figs are beloved today for their unique flavor and texture. Not to mention, they offer some health perks, too: figs contain some potassium and vitamin A.

Balsamic glaze is my favorite new find, it’s thick and sweet and you can drizzle it on salad, sandwiches or even strawberries. I bought mine in Trader Joe’s but I see it in stores everywhere now. It’s pairs perfectly with figs, and you only need to drizzle a little olive oil on top. You can serve this salad on a large platter with olive oil and balsamic on the side, or you can serve them on plates, one fig per person. If goat cheese isn’t your thing, gorgonzola would make a perfect replacement. You could even add slivered almonds or walnuts.

Total: 15 minutes
Yield: 8 servings
Serving Size: 1 cup arugula w/ cheese, 1 fig, 1 tbsp balsamic glaze, 1/2 tsp extra virgin olive oil.

Ingredients

  • 8 cups baby arugula
  • 8 fresh figs, washed and quartered
  • 1.75 oz semi-soft goat cheese
  • 1/2 cup balsamic glaze
  • 4 tsp extra virgin oil

Instructions

  • Arrange arugula on a salad bowl or platter, or you can divide on 8 salad plates.
  • Top with quartered figs and goat cheese and serve with balsamic glaze and olive oil on the side.

Nutrition

Serving: 1 cup arugula w/ cheese, 1 fig, 1 tbsp balsamic glaze, 1/2 tsp extra virgin olive oil., Calories: 124.5 kcal, Carbohydrates: 20.5 g, Protein: 2 g, Fat: 4.5 g, Sodium: 43 mg, Fiber: 2 g, Sugar: 15 g
